The Role of Rod Action and Power

A crucial aspect of tackle selection lies in understanding rod action and power. Rod action refers to how much the rod bends along its length, while power defines the amount of force required to bend the rod. Faster action rods bend primarily at the tip, providing greater sensitivity and casting distance, ideal for techniques like jigging or twitching lures. Slower action rods bend more throughout the length, offering more forgiveness and cushioning for fighting larger fish. Power ratings, from ultralight to extra heavy, dictate the weight of lures and lines the rod can effectively handle. Catch and Release Techniques

Catch and release is a vital conservation tool, allowing anglers to enjoy the sport while minimizing harm to fish populations. Proper catch and release techniques are crucial for ensuring the fish’s survival. This includes using barbless hooks, minimizing air exposure, supporting the fish horizontally, and gently releasing it back into the water. Avoid touching the fish’s gills or eyes, as these are sensitive areas. Keeping the fish in the water as much as possible reduces stress and increases its chances of recovery.
